Hit the new Natick Mall, err, Natick Collection, today. In fact, it’s already been “Web 2.0-ized” with this Wikipedia entry.
Just opened yesterday and the structure is indeed impressive, despite it not being fully complete. Also, a few well needed, top notch chain restaurants have been added: The Cheesecake Factory, P. F. Chang’s China Bistro. In between dodging slack jawed teens, baby strollers and generally out-of-shape Americans, I couldn’t help but think – “who is going to shop at these luxury stores – Giorgio Armani, Juicy Couture, L’Occitane, Louis Vuitton, Lucky Brand Jeans, Martin + Osa, Max Mara, RUEHL No.925, Salvatore Ferragamo, Stuart Weitzman, and Zara???”
Yes, the mall was packed on day 2. But will it be on day 222? I hope so, but unfortunately, I think not. The latest news from Wall Street is far from promising.
Maybe I’ll be able to get that $150 Tommy Bahama at markdown in a few months…
